I am thinking again about #DreadDelusion. And I think that people 30 years ago might have been able to build a game that looks just like this and plays just like this on the hardware from 30 years ago.
But I'm wondering if people 30 years ago could have even imagined that a game could be like this?
Final Fantasy 6 was already out 30 years ago, and Metal Gear Solid had already started development. But I feel this is a game that could only be conceptualized with decades of game history behind it. -
